Claims
- 1. A process for the preparation of a multi-layer gas-barrier drawn polyester bottle, which comprises (i) forming by co-extrusion a multi-layer pipe comprising (a) outer and inner layers of polyethylene terephthalate, (b) a gas-barrier intermediate layer of an ethylene-vinyl alcohol copolymer having an ethylene content of 15 to 50 mole % and (c) adhesive layers interposed between the gas-barrier intermediate layer and each of the outer and inner layers, each of said adhesive layers consisting of a nylon 6/nylon 6,6 copolymer having a nylon 6 content of 50 to 93 mole % and having a relative viscosity (.eta. rel) of 1.8 to 3.5 as measured at 20.degree. C. with respect to a solution of 1 gram of the polymer in 10 cc of 98% sulfuric acid, and the copolyamide adhesive having such characteristics that the peel strength between the polyethylene terephthalate layer and the ethylene-vinyl alcohol copolymer layer is 20 to 800 g/20 mm of the width in the state of a bottle, (ii) forming a neck portion at one end of the multi-layer pipe and forming a bottom at another end of the multi-layer pipe to form a bottomed preform, and (iii) draw-blowing the bottomed preform to form a bottle molecularly oriented biaxially in the axial direction and hoop direction.
- 2. A process as set forth in claim 1, wherein the adhesive layer has a thickness in the range from about 5 microns at about 50 microns.
- 3. A process as set forth in claim 1, wherein the ethylene/vinyl alcohol copolymer gas-barrier intermediate layer has an ethylene content of from 15 to 50 mole % and a saponification degree of at least 96%.
- 4. A process as set forth in claim 1, wherein the ethylene/vinyl alcohol copolymer gas-barrier intermediate layer has an ethylene content of from 25 to 45 mole % and a saponification degree of at least 96%.
- 5. A multi-layer gas-barrier drawn polyester vessel, which comprises an open end portion, a barrel portion which is molecularly oriented in at least one axial direction and a closed bottom portion, said vessel having a multi-layer structure comprising (a) outer and inner layers of polyethylene terephthalate, (b) a gas-barrier intermediate layer of an ethylene-vinyl alcohol copolymer having an ethylene content of 15 to 50 mole % and (c) adhesive layers interposed between the gas-barrier intermediate layer and each of the outer and inner layers, each of said adhesive layers consisting of a nylon 6/nylon 6,6 copolymer having a nylon 6 content of 50 to 93 mole % and having a relative viscosity (.eta. rel) of 1.8 to 3.5 as measured at 20.degree. C. with respect to a solution of 1 gram of the polymer in 10 cc of 98% sulfuric acid, and the copolyamide adhesive having such characteristic that the peel strength between the polyethylene terephthalate layer and the ethylene-vinyl alcohol copolymer layer is 20 to 800 g/20 mm of the width.
